Patna: In a significant move, state cabinet led by Chief Minister Nitish Kumar on Tuesday, February 4 accorded nod to a record 136 proposals, during a cabinet meet held in the capital city.
The cabinet during the meet discussed and accorded nod to as many as 82 schemes along approval for hosting the world cup championship for women’s kabaddi. The development marks the highest ever agenda approved by the Chief Minister Kumar since he assumed office.
The CM during his ‘Pragiti Yatra’ in the northern districts of the State had announced a total of 188 schemes, costing around Rs 20000 Crore. A total of 82 schemes entailing an expenditure of around Rs 13142 crore were accorded nod in the cabinet meet held on Tuesday. A total of 67 schemes were approved at the department levels while the state cabinet during its previous meet had given nod to as many as 39 schemes, informed a senior official of the State government.
The cabinet has also given nod to host the women Kabaddi world championship which will be organised in March this year at the newly built sports academy in Rajgir. The championship will witness participation of teams from 16 countries. The cabinet has also approved the hosting of world cup of Sepak Takraw for both men and women this year at Patliputra sports complex in the capital town.
Government to develop Harihar Mandir Kshetra and other religious sites
The state cabinet also approved tourism department’s proposal to develop notable religious sites in the State. This include overall development of the Harihar temple area in Sonepur, various development work at Someshawar nath temple at Areraj, Siheneshwar Sthan at Madhepura, Kusheshwar Sthan of Darbhanga, Pooran Devi temple in Purnia and others.

The cabinet has approved the selection of H.C.P Design planning and management Pvt. Ltd as principal consultant on nomination basis for the overall development of Baba Hariharnath Temple area at Sonepur. The company has earlier planned and designed the Vishwanath corridor at Varanasi.
Land acquisition for greenfield airport to begin soon
Meanwhile, Deputy CM and Finance Minister, Samrat Choudhary on Tuesday said that the State government would soon begin the land acquisition process for the proposed greenfield airports at Rajgir, Bhagalpur and Sonepur.
“We are going to start the land acquisition process for the three greenfield airports announced in the central budget. The process will commence at this month’ end,” said Choudhary. The BJP leader further emphasised that “once completed, the newly built airports would boost the aviation connectivity in the State.”
Notably,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man on January 31 announced three greenfield airport for Bihar in addition to expanding the capacity of Patna Airport and constructing a brownfield airport in Bihta.
The FM also announced several other projects for the State, including establishment of a Makahana board and National Institute of Food Technology.
She also highlighted the Western Kosi Canal ERM project in the Mithilanchal region of the State, announcing that financial support will be provided for the Western Kosi Canal project, benefitting a large number of farmers cultivating over 50,000 hectares of land in the Mithilanchal region.
